Silent Soldier Campaign
14th August 2018

Diddlebury Parish Council has commissioned the erection of a Silent Soldier next to the War memorial in St. Peter's Church, Diddlebury.

The cost of the Silent Soldier is £200, and the Parish Council is seeking contributions towards the cost.
